You cannot book Jeff B Davis right now. Please come back later!
Be the first to know when Jeff B Davis goes live. Sign up and we will get back to you!

Press

BBC
Forbes
Wired
Business Insider
Skynews
Daily Mirror
Metro
The Scotsman
CITY A.M.
The Sun